Ewan Aitken Steps Down to Empower Others

from Edinburgh News Today | 2 Min News | The Daily News Now!

After 12 years as CEO, Ewan Aitken is stepping down—not retiring, but slowing down to pursue personal passions. With over 30 years in leadership, Aitken champions empowering others over controlling them, believing true success comes from trusting capable people with the resources and belief they need. He’s seen profound transformations at Cyrenians, where rediscovering love and connection is as vital as meeting material needs. His leadership philosophy centers on delegation, not domination—because hoarding power stifles growth. Guided by core values of compassion, respect, integrity, and innovation, Cyrenians supports even those who’ve made tough choices, never giving up on anyone while holding them accountable.
